I've just installed Mint8 KDE CE, and so far I'm very pleased, but a few things are driving me nuts, and I'm hoping someone can tell me how to fix them. (More in separate posts.)
Every time I click on a file, a new instance of the relevant application opens, rather than using the one that's already open. i.e., if I click on a text file in Dolphin, I get a 2nd instance of Kate, rather than using the one that's already open. Same for VLC, and OpenOffice.
Is there some way to say "reuse same instance of app?"

For vlc, you can set it to only allow single instance. open vlc, press ctrl+p, on interface settings, just after the skins section, tick the box for allow only one instance.

EDIT: At least I found a way to do it for Kate:
1. Configure Kate to load the last used session on startup and save sessions on exit, and enable the window configuration session element.
2. Add:
--use %U
to Kate in Menu editor.
